General Information
Host Institution Name: Norwegian University of Life Sciences (NMBU)
Campus Location(s): Ås, Norway
Language(s) of Instruction: English or Norwegian
Application Deadline:
  • 1st Semester: March 15th
  • 2nd Semester: September 15th
Nomination Deadline:
  • 1st Semester: April 1st
  • 2nd Semester: October 1st
Academic Calendar:
  • 1st Semester: September - December
  • 2nd Semester: February - May
Partnership Type(s):
  • Bilateral Academic Exchange
Area(s) of Exchange Agreement:
Credit Conversion: 1 Acadia credit is equal to 2 ECTS
Cost of Living: Living in As
Accommodations: Residence available through SiÅs
Do I require a visa?

Yes, students will require a Norwegian Study permit. Please visit UDI website and NMBU 'First-time Study Permit' webpage for more information and next steps if accepted to NMBU.
